Uploaded image for project: 'JBoss Web Server'
  1. JBoss Web Server
  2. JWS-507

RHEL6 Tomcats libtcnative links to missing libapr-jws3-1.so.0

    XMLWordPrintable

Details

    • Bug
    • Resolution: Done
    • Blocker
    • JWS 3.1.0 DR3
    • JWS 3.1.0 DR2
    • tomcat-native
    • None

    Description

      05-Sep-2016 05:05:46.128 WARNING [main] org.apache.catalina.core.AprLifecycleListener.init The APR based Apache Tomcat Native library failed to load. The error reported was [/tmp/mod_cluster-ews/jws-3.1/tomcat8/lib/libtcnative-1.so: libapr-jws3-1.so.0: cannot open shared object file: No such file or directory]
       java.lang.UnsatisfiedLinkError: /tmp/mod_cluster-ews/jws-3.1/tomcat8/lib/libtcnative-1.so: libapr-jws3-1.so.0: cannot open shared object file: No such file or directory
      	at java.lang.ClassLoader$NativeLibrary.load(Native Method)
      	at java.lang.ClassLoader.loadLibrary1(ClassLoader.java:1965)
      	at java.lang.ClassLoader.loadLibrary0(ClassLoader.java:1890)
      	at java.lang.ClassLoader.loadLibrary(ClassLoader.java:1880)
      	at java.lang.Runtime.loadLibrary0(Runtime.java:849)
      	at java.lang.System.loadLibrary(System.java:1088)
      	at org.apache.tomcat.jni.Library.<init>(Library.java:42)
      	at org.apache.tomcat.jni.Library.initialize(Library.java:178)
      	at org.apache.catalina.core.AprLifecycleListener.init(AprLifecycleListener.java:197)
      	at org.apache.catalina.core.AprLifecycleListener.isAprAvailable(AprLifecycleListener.java:106)
      	at org.apache.catalina.connector.Connector.setProtocol(Connector.java:564)
      	at org.apache.catalina.connector.Connector.<init>(Connector.java:66)
      	at org.apache.catalina.startup.ConnectorCreateRule.begin(ConnectorCreateRule.java:62)
      	at org.apache.tomcat.util.digester.Digester.startElement(Digester.java:1188)
      	at com.sun.org.apache.xerces.internal.parsers.AbstractSAXParser.startElement(AbstractSAXParser.java:509)
      	at com.sun.org.apache.xerces.internal.parsers.AbstractXMLDocumentParser.emptyElement(AbstractXMLDocumentParser.java:182)
      	at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anStartElement(XMLDocumentFragmentScannerImpl.java:1343)
      	at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l$FragmentContentDriver.next(XMLDocumentFragmentScannerImpl.java:2786)
      	at com.sun.org.apache.xerces.internal.impl.XMLDocumentScannerImpl.next(XMLDocumentScannerImpl.java:606)
      	at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anDocument(XMLDocumentFragmentScannerImpl.java:510)
      	at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(XML11Configuration.java:848)
      	at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(XML11Configuration.java:777)
      	at com.sun.org.apache.xerces.internal.parsers.XMLParser.parse(XMLParser.java:141)
      	at com.sun.org.apache.xerces.internal.parsers.AbstractSAXParser.parse(AbstractSAXParser.java:1213)
      	at com.sun.org.apache.xerces.internal.jaxp.SAXParserImpl$JAXPSAXParser.parse(SAXParserImpl.java:648)
      	at org.apache.tomcat.util.digester.Digester.parse(Digester.java:1461)
      	at org.apache.catalina.startup.Catalina.load(Catalina.java:552)
      	at org.apache.catalina.startup.Catalina.start(Catalina.java:617)
      	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
      	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
      	at java.lang.reflect.Method.invoke(Method.java:606)
      	at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:351)
      	at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:485)
      
      05-Sep-2016 05:05:46.355 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Server version:        Apache Tomcat/8.0.36
      05-Sep-2016 05:05:46.355 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Server built:          Aug 31 2016 18:17:50 UTC
      05-Sep-2016 05:05:46.355 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Server number:         8.0.36-3.ep7.el6.0
      05-Sep-2016 05:05:46.355 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log OS Name:               Linux
      05-Sep-2016 05:05:46.355 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log OS Version:            2.6.32-573.3.1.el6.x86_64
      05-Sep-2016 05:05:46.355 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Architecture:          amd64
      05-Sep-2016 05:05:46.355 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Java Home:             /qa/tools/opt/x86_64/jdk1.7.0_79/jre
      05-Sep-2016 05:05:46.355 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log JVM Version:           1.7.0_79-b15
      05-Sep-2016 05:05:46.356 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log JVM Vendor:            Oracle Corporation
      05-Sep-2016 05:05:46.356 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log CATALINA_BASE:         /tmp/mod_cluster-ews/jws-3.1/tomcat8
      05-Sep-2016 05:05:46.356 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log CATALINA_HOME:         /tmp/mod_cluster-ews/jws-3.1/tomcat8
      05-Sep-2016 05:05:46.356 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.util.logging.config.file=/tmp/mod_cluster-ews/jws-3.1/tomcat8/conf/logging.properties
      05-Sep-2016 05:05:46.356 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.util.logging.manager=org.apache.juli.ClassLoaderLogManager
      05-Sep-2016 05:05:46.356 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Xms128m
      05-Sep-2016 05:05:46.357 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Xmx128m
      05-Sep-2016 05:05:46.357 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.net.preferIPv4Stack=true
      05-Sep-2016 05:05:46.357 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djdk.tls.ephemeralDHKeySize=2048
      05-Sep-2016 05:05:46.357 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.library.path=/tmp/mod_cluster-ews/jws-3.1/tomcat8/lib
      05-Sep-2016 05:05:46.357 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.security.egd=file:///dev/urandom
      05-Sep-2016 05:05:46.357 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.endorsed.dirs=/tmp/mod_cluster-ews/jws-3.1/tomcat8/endorsed
      05-Sep-2016 05:05:46.357 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Dcatalina.base=/tmp/mod_cluster-ews/jws-3.1/tomcat8
      05-Sep-2016 05:05:46.357 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Dcatalina.home=/tmp/mod_cluster-ews/jws-3.1/tomcat8
      05-Sep-2016 05:05:46.358 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.io.tmpdir=/tmp/mod_cluster-ews/jws-3.1/tomcat8/tem
      

      Attachments

        Activity

          People

            weli@redhat.com Weinan Li
            mbabacek1@redhat.com Michal Karm
            Michal Karm Michal Karm
            Votes:
            0 Vote for this issue
            Watchers:
            4 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: